Ben Hillyer/The Natchez Democrat — Jim Lessley had no problem kicking up his heels as he danced with Margaret Guido during the Margaret Martin Back-to-School Barbecue. The old-fashioned sock hop in the school library was just one of the many events at the old high school. Funds from Saturday’s events will go to the interior restoration of the school.

As Burnley Cook tickles the ivories with his version of “Great Balls of Fire,” Jerry Hawthorne and Corinne Randazzo take a spin on the dance floor during the barbecue. After a good dinner cooked by Allen Brown and his crew, alumni and friends were treated to a tour of the school and then the sock hop in the old school library, the same room Randazzo worked in as school librarian.

Ben Hillyer/The Natchez Democrat — The dance floor was filled Saturday night in the old Margaret Martin School library as part of the Margaret Martin Back-to-School Barbecue. The fundraiser at the old high school included an old fashioned sock hop, meal and a tour of the building.
